Magic Mousse Jell-O

What you will need:

  • Jell-O package (3 oz size) , any flavor (I think the berry flavors are best with this recipe)
  • 1 1/2 cups boiling water
  • 1 8oz tub of Cool Whip, frozen or thawed.
  • Berries, any kind, frozen or fresh about 1 pint.

Pour the Jell-O in a bowl. Mix with the boiling water until completely dissolved, about 1-2 minutes. Quickly add the cool whip in large chunks, stirring the mixture with a whisk until completely dissolved.

Place a few berries in the bottom of your cups. Pour Jell-O mixture over the berries, and refrigerate for 4 hours. Jell-o will magically layer while it is setting.

When set, top with more Cool Whip and eat up the yummy goodness!

Makes 4 1/2 cup servings. Enjoy!
